Hydrogen Electrolyzer Infrastructure Market: Size, Share, Trends, Forecast & Growth Analysis 2034 Enabling a Hydrogen-powered Future

 

 

Hydrogen Electrolyzer Infrastructure Market  is entering a period of rapid growth, driven by global decarbonization efforts and rising demand for green hydrogen. The market is valued at $0.4 billion in 2024 and is expected to reach $41.2 billion by 2034, growing at a CAGR of 42.1%. This growth is fueled by the need for clean energy and the increasing use of hydrogen in energy storage, transportation, industrial manufacturing, and chemical production.

Hydrogen electrolyzer infrastructure includes advanced technologies, installation, power systems, and operational support for large-scale hydrogen production via electrolysis. With green hydrogen becoming central to the net-zero transition, countries in Europe, Asia-Pacific, and North America are investing heavily in electrolyzer capacity, grid integration, and supportive policiesAlkaline and PEM electrolyzers lead the market, offering scalable and efficient solutions to meet diverse energy needs.

Market Dynamics

Hydrogen Electrolyzer Infrastructure Market is growing rapidly due to several key factors. Government incentives, clean energy targets, and strategic hydrogen roadmaps are driving global adoption. Alkaline electrolyzers remain popular for their cost-effectiveness and large-scale capabilities, while PEM electrolyzers are gaining ground thanks to flexibility and compatibility with renewable energy.

Technological improvements have lowered production costs, making green hydrogen more competitive. However, the market faces challenges such as high upfront investment, supply chain disruptions, geopolitical tensions, and variable renewable energy availabilityTrade tariffs in Europe and Asia and Middle East conflicts also affect raw material costs and infrastructure deployment.

Despite these challenges, the market outlook is strong. Rising demand from automotive, aerospace, chemical manufacturing, and energy storage sectors, along with new business models like hydrogen-as-a-service, is creating significant growth opportunities.

Regional Analysis

The regional landscape of the Hydrogen Electrolyzer Infrastructure Market highlights strong momentum across advanced economies and emerging energy hubs. Asia-Pacific is rapidly becoming a global leader, with China, Japan, and South Korea significantly increasing investments in hydrogen technologies. These nations are accelerating clean energy strategies to enhance energy security and meet ambitious carbon reduction targets. North America follows closely, led by the United States and Canada, where clean energy incentives, industrial decarbonization programs, and large-scale renewable energy projects are propelling adoption. Europe remains a powerhouse, supported by the EU’s aggressive net-zero ambitions and extensive funding for green hydrogen deployment. Countries like Germany, France, and the Netherlands are establishing hydrogen valleys and expanding interconnected hydrogen networks. The Middle East and Africa are gradually positioning themselves as future hydrogen exporters, leveraging abundant natural resources and supportive government policies. Meanwhile, Latin America, particularly Brazil, is harnessing renewable energy potential to strengthen green hydrogen production capabilities.

Recent News & Developments

The market has seen several pivotal developments that underscore accelerating global interest in hydrogen. Siemens Energy and Air Liquide announced a major joint venture to boost Europe’s electrolyzer production capacity, aligning with regional hydrogen expansion goals. In the United States, Plug Power unveiled plans for a gigafactory aimed at strengthening domestic electrolyzer manufacturing and reducing import dependency. ITM Power secured substantial investment from a European consortium to expand its production capabilities and drive innovation. In Asia, Sinopec began constructing what is expected to be the world’s largest hydrogen electrolyzer facility, marking a milestone in China’s clean energy ambitions. Additionally, the European Union introduced new regulatory frameworks and financial incentives to accelerate hydrogen infrastructure deployment, providing tax benefits and subsidies for electrolyzer projects. These developments highlight strong industry collaboration and a rising urgency to scale hydrogen production across global markets.
